Ireland - Bovine Meat Slaughterings

Since 2015, Ireland Bovine Meat Slaughterings increased 2.5% year on year. In 2020, the country was number 7 comparing other countries in Bovine Meat Slaughterings with 1,882.05 Thousand Heads. Ireland is overtaken by Netherlands, which was ranked number 6 at 2,086.35 Thousand Heads and is followed by Poland at 1,851.22 Thousand Heads. France ranked the highest with 4,486.48 Thousand Heads in 2020, that is a fall of 1.3% versus 2019. Germany, United Kingdom and Italy resp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Montenegro recorded the best 5 years average growth at +6.3% per year, while Bosnia and Herzegovina recorded the worst performance at -10.2% per year.
